I cook the stuff that takes a long time to cook through first - like potates etc., and then throw the fast cook vegetables like broccoli 2 minutes before serving , and then spinach a minute before serving....

The Asians do the soup stock first, with the meat and spices etc., and when they are cooked, they add things like cabbage and then bok choy in at the last minute... literally 1 minute.. so the vegetables are HOT, fresh and crisp....

My old man used to boil everything to death....

Asian soups etc., changed my mind on how to make brilliant soups and foods.

Most of the cooking is in the timing and the speed..... get any soft vegetable, like celery, onion, bok choy, cabbage, and drop some into boiling water, and watch it go from crisp and fresh, to soggy and floppy.... The idea in Asian soups is to be fast - thanks to the induction cookers, I now toss mince in a pot, some water and the frozen vegetables, and turn it up high and bring it to a boil for no more than a minute... Add all the spices and sauces and flavourings - done - meal to table = 5 minutes. BUT making a soups stock - meat and all... some might take a while too cook.. and flavour up the water... then just add the fresh vegetables at the very last minute or two... If you notice the soups in the bowls, the soft vergetable are only added in the last minute... so they are HOT but not WILTED...... Spring Onions, Celery, Bok Choy, Chilie, carrot, cucumber, cabbage etc..
